He was born inCharlottetown, Prince Edward Island, the son of Arthur J. Bell and Sarah MacKenzie, and was educated atPrince of Wales College. Bell articled in law with G. S. Inman and was admitted to the bar in 1927. In 1934, he married Helena J. Rogers, the granddaughter ofBenjamin Rogers. Bell was a lieutenant in the battery reserve duringWorld War II. He was namedKing's Counselin 1946. In 1947, he purchased a farm where he raised cattle, hogs and sheep.
